About This Novel
Following the aroma, soul, and culture of wine in ancient poetry, we analyze the spiritual world and taste of life conveyed by poetry and wine. This is an appreciation of ancient poetry, but the focus is not on the analysis itself, but on thinking about life and interpreting the world through poetry. The whole book is based on emotion and is divided into four parts: joy, thought, sadness, and indulgence, which represent the four emotional tones of wine. The author selects 24 wine poems from past dynasties, representing 24 kinds of emotions. Through words full of tension and expression, it conveys a large number of valuable cultural and social messages, and is highly artistic and readable.
